Gardai in Dublin say they’re surprised that criminals are using assault weapons – similar to those used by the Irish army.
Five firearms, including three sub-machine guns were seized – along with 5.2 million euro worth of heroin and cocaine in the course of the investigation.

Gardai display evidence, including a blender, used to mix heroin. There are traces of brown heroin on the base of the liquidiser.
Gardai say the seizure this week of over 33 kg of heroin will cause a drought in the capital.
Detective Inspector Colm O'Malley says they believe the drugs were destined for the Irish market, and it's a sizeable seizure;
